-main-is flag should change exports in default module header
The -main-is option to GHC should probably change the export list for the default module header. It doesn't.
$ cat Main.hs
program = return ()
$ ghc -main-is Main.program Main.hs
[1 of 1] Compiling Main ( Main.hs, Main.o )
Main.hs:1:1: error:
Not in scope: ‘main’
Perhaps you meant ‘min’ (imported from Prelude)
Main.hs:1:1: error:
The main IO action ‘program’ is not exported by module ‘Main’
I cannot imagine any possible use case for a feature that changes the entry point name to something else, and then deliberately fails to export the symbol by that name. This seems like an obvious thing to fix.
